Handover — Digestline scheduler. Batch email digests run nightly; the Marwick tenant runs twice daily, that's intentional. If a run stalls, kill the worker and requeue — never resend manually, it double-mails. Retry backoff was retuned last week, leave it. Dashboard alerts at 30 min lag are noise below 45. Current production scheduler settings are listed below for reference.

deployment values, kahof-yadug:
[gorys]
team = silael
access_code = ac_00d620
owner = istox.oliys
host = gorys.torvastack.example
port = 9000
peer = holmir.merlaqsoft.example
salt = 9fdae78a
pin = 2358

### Waveform previews

Quick heads-up for the sync: the new `/previews/waveform` endpoint on Soundline renders a peaks JSON for any uploaded clip, so the editor UI can draw waveforms without pulling full audio. It's synchronous under 10MB, async above that with a callback. It's gated behind the internal preview service for now, so calls need service auth. Requests authenticate against the Soundline preview service using the key below.

service key, fawip-bajef: kto11_Qt5wZK9vdNC

Our collector expects compressed batches under 2 MB; oversized or uncompressed payloads are rejected silently in older pipeline images, which makes failures hard to spot. Verify your plugin negotiates compression during the handshake rather than assuming it. If rejections persist after enabling compression, capture the collector logs and open an issue. Include the build token from your failing CI run, printed below.

pipeline stamp: htk9_ce63042d9

# Logistics Transition: Move to Brindlehart Freight (Managers Only)

This page summarises the planned switch from Orvec Haulage to Brindlehart Freight for all regional distribution. Sales leads should note revised cutoff times for order dispatch and a two-week parallel running period. Customer-facing delivery promises must not change until the transition is confirmed stable. Escalation paths will be published separately. Questions go to the distribution steering group. Please keep the note below strictly within this group.

confidential, yaweg-bafog: The western region missed its Druael quota by 42.1 percent last quarter. Wenokix Group plans to raise the Alddor list price by 36.3 percent in June. The finance team signed off on a budget of $272.6 million for Project Rusax. The renewal with Istiusix Systems closes at $334.2 million a year, 62.9 percent below the last contract.